Dealing With A Collection Agency

Step I - Picking A Debt Collector

Choosing a credit debt collector is maybe the most important and tough task. Some factors you should think about while picking a debt collector are:

- Experience and professionals

- Geographical presence

- Knowledge

- Costs and charging design

- Consumer references

Step II - Hiring the Collection Agency and Setting Up Processes

When you choose the debt collection agency, the very first 2 actions you need to take are:

Participate in an agreement with the agency;

Establish procedures on how you are going to interact with the agency.

You are most likely to pass delicate info to the collection agency such as your account receivables, consumer contacts, item and services rates, and so on to help with faster debt collection. You desire to be sure that this info does not fall in the wrong hands.

Setting up processes is a very important step in dealing with the debt collector. The success or failure of your collaboration will depend a lot on how distinct your procedures are and how strictly they are followed. Essential processes you need to define are:

Internal procedures: You need to put in place a clear procedure on defining bad debt and referring the case to the collection agency. You don't wish to refer the case to the collection agency prior to you make a sincere effort to collect the dues internally.

Details transfer: How will you move the info to the debt collection agency about your dues and defaulting customers, and how will you get the info from your debt collection agency? Debt collection software can make the details transfer procedure simple and secured.

3rd party dealing: As pointed out previously, it is extremely important for you to ensure the security of the details you offer to the debt collection agency. The collection agency might utilize one or more of its associated firms to get information about defaulting consumers. For this reason you need to set up a clear procedure on just how much information they can show such 3rd parties.

Interaction: You need to establish single point contacts for interaction within the collection and the business agency. In debt collection practices, the timing of interaction is incredibly crucial and thus it will go a long way in choosing the success of your debt collection procedure. Action III - Efficiency Tracking

When all procedures are set, begin monitoring the efficiency of the debt collector. When dealing with a collection agency, this is a continuous process. Essential parameters to keep an eye on are:

Quantitative

- Number of cases described the credit debt collector and percentage of cases successfully resolved by them.

- Portion of debt recovered by the collection agency from all cases referred.

- Percentage of debt recuperated by the debt collection agency from fixed cases.

- Percentage of quantity paid as fees/commission to the collection agency to the total uncollectable bill cases referred to them.

- Typical variety of days taken by the debt collection agency for full/partial credit collection.

Qualitative

* How well do the collection agency specialists deal with your clients?

* Has the collection agency followed all legal requirements pointed out in the Fair Debt Collection Practices Act?

* Has the collection agency exceeded the provisions of the Fair Debt Collection Practices Act?

* Has the debt collection agency followed all standards and processes set by you?

Action IV - Agreement Closure

Hopefully, the picked collection agency will work best for you. However if it doesn't, then you need to move all your debt collection processes from the agency. You should remember the following crucial points when you are ending the contract:

Privacy and non-disclosure stipulations are applicable after completion of the contract with the debt collection agency along with its employees. The debt collection agency returns all files related to your service and destroys all info related to your service from their data storage.
